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Sift together the flour, and baking soda, set aside.
- In a medium bowl, cream the white sugar and brown sugar with the butter. Stir in the eggs, one at a time, then the vanilla and peanut butter. Add the dry ingredients to the creamed mixture and stir until combined. Finally, stir in the nuts, chocolate chips and coconut.
- Drop by heaping teaspoonfuls onto cookie sheets.
- Bake for 12 to 15 minutes in the preheated oven. Cool on wire racks.
